To be brutally honest however, crafting magic items in this game is royally screwed up and not worth your time. I would stick to simply crafting armor and weapons using special materials if at all. The developers implemented some really strange item requirement system in order to do away with the Experience requirements necessary for crafting items. All well and good, but it's a pain in the ass. Not to mention the ridiculous gold cost increases. :rolleyes: Crafting rules in this game make you kind of have to spawn gold like crazy to make them how the game should have been in the first place.

Original Item: Cold Iron Shortsword that came with Shandra.

I enchanted it to:

Fiery Cold Iron Shortsword +3

1d6 Fire Damage
Enhancement Bonus +3 (I wasn't a high enough spellcaster for more than that)

Spells required: Light; Fireball
Gems: Emerald; Ruby
Essences: Weak Air, Faint Power; Weak Fire

And of course, one well-forged shortsword made of cold Iron.

The Crafting System is not critical to your sucess in the OC, but it will NOT hinder you in ANY way. And NOW, Shandra is pure MURDER with her shortsword.....
